卸载依赖项后添加的npm包

卸载依赖项后添加的npm包,npm,Npm,为什么在调用npm uninstall后我看到消息添加了软件包 例如: $ npm uninstall -S redux-devtools-dock-monitor redux-devtools-log-monitor redux-devtools np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@1.1.2 (node_modules/fsevents): npm WARN notsup SKIPPING OPTIONAL DEP

为什么在调用
npm uninstall
后我看到消息
添加了软件包

例如:

$ npm uninstall -S redux-devtools-dock-monitor redux-devtools-log-monitor redux-devtools
npm WARN optional SKIPPING OPTIONAL DEPENDENCY: fsevents@1.1.2 (node_modules/fsevents):
npm WARN notsup SKIPPING OPTIONAL DEPENDENCY: Unsupported platform for fsevents@1.1.2: wanted {"os":"darwin","arch":"any"} (current: {"os":"linux","arch":"x64"})

added 115 packages and removed 22 packages in 20.589s
对于这个特定的示例,至少这里有一些已删除的包。有时它只显示
添加的包
消息

有人能澄清一下吗


UPD:我从头开始做了一个小测试,但卸载某个东西时,一切正常。但我经常看到像上面这样的信息

但它真的在安装新的软件包吗?@IsidroTorregrosa问得好:)我没有检查。但也许以后会这样做。我认为这可能是树摇晃的结果。。。或者不是。但它真的在安装新的软件包吗?@IsidroTorregrosa问得好:)我没有检查。但也许以后会这样做。我认为这可能是树摇晃的结果。。。或者不是。